当前位置:当前位置: 首页 >
Rust 使用 Result 的错误处理方式与 Golang 使用 error 的方式有什么本质区别?
文章出处:网络 人气:发表时间:2025-06-26 23:35:17
rust 的 result 是枚举,只有2个答案,要么ok要么不ok,不ok的时候,err带错误信息。
golang 的 error ,只是多返回值,***设有2个返回值,其实一个给了error,那么用户可以造4个组合的返回: 1,有返回值,有error 2,有返回值,无error 3,无返回值,无error 4,无返回值,有error 理论上,google 希望的是2和4。
虽然现实多数也是这么用的,但是我真碰到过1和3的。
这时候,就很惆怅 。
只要碰到过一次,你就蛋疼了。
因…。
同类文章排行
- 如何编译DPDK-22.11?
- 如何看待王婆相亲中女孩坦诚自己怀孕3个月,男方就直接拒绝了?
- 你在生活中见过哪些「强者从不抱怨环境」的例子?
- 有性瘾女朋友每天都要很多遍要不要分手?
- 为什么越来越多的国内男孩,要娶国外女孩?
- 《西虹市首富》里面想花完钱却越花越多的情况,现实里面会发生吗?
- 一个人可以蠢到什么程度?
- 能分享一下你写过的rust项目吗?
- MacBook的诱惑在哪里?
- 开发了一个App,上线之后一个用户也没有怎么办?
最新资讯文章
- 如何评价近期开播的《长安的荔枝》?
- 可以随身携带一个Linux系统吗?
- 女友明确说不喜欢我玩游戏机,结婚后也不允许我买游戏机,并且跟我吵架了,该如何是好?
- 为啥中国把《水浒传》拍得这么土?
- 单依纯和黄霄云谁颜值更高一点?
- 中国大陆地区献血率为何如此低下?
- 为什么男生都不喜欢173身高的女生啊?
- 你在国产电影或电视剧里见过哪些脱离实际生活的离谱设定?
- 如何评价高圆圆的身材算是美女类型的吗?
- Gradle 是否已经对安卓的发展构成了阻碍?
- 媒体称以色列防空成本一晚近 3 亿美元,最多再撑 12 天,美方会支援吗?若无美补给结果会如何?
- 美军 B-2 轰炸机参与袭击伊朗核设施,B-2轰炸机战斗力如何?会摧毁伊朗核设施吗?
- 华为Pura 80首销遇冷,是否说明消费者已经开始对麒麟芯片性能有所觉醒?
- 火车上有女生让你帮她放一个26寸的行李箱到行李架上,你会帮忙吗?
- 如何看待 Rust 的应用前景?